- Why ETABS Training: Engineers use it to analyze loads, design buildings, and generate reports efficiently. As a student, a beginner, or a professional, understanding ETABS can boost career opportunities. It is preferred by most companies to hire candidates who possess ETABS skills since it saves time and enhances structural design quality. Without training, one cannot learn about the features and functionality of the software. One is led by a systematic course on how to model, analyze, and design. An ETABS course should preferably instruct load calculations, seismic analysis, reinforcement detailing, and cross-verifying the results of designs. Some courses also instruct students in manual design methods alongside computer-based design, enabling them to compare theoretical and practical results with ease. Skills in documentation and detailing are also necessary because structural engineers must document their designs. A suitable ETABS course ensures that students gain hands-on experience and know the actual uses of the software.
- Choosing Between Classroom and Online Training: The initial choice to make when selecting an ETABS course is whether to choose online training or classroom training. Both have their advantages, and the choice depends on personal preference and learning style. Classroom training provides personal interaction with instructors, and it is easy to clear doubts and raise questions. It allows students to work on live projects under guidance. Nevertheless, classroom training courses may become more affordable at greater fees with the requirement to travel, though not always well-liked by everyone. By contrast, online ETABS courses are getting popular due to their flexibility and affordability. It is common on most online portals to have access to recorded lessons and live lessons, which help students learn without any constraints of time. Many online courses cover the same study material as the classroom training at reduced prices. Before getting registered, verify whether the course includes practical exercises, assignments, and case studies on industry parameters. Practical hands-on training is crucial in mastering ETABS and hence the course must include enough hands-on practice.
- Evaluating Course Material and Instructor Knowledge: The quality of an ETABS course is mostly dependent on its content and instructor’s proficiency. A good course must have both theoretical and practical elements. The course syllabus should include basic topics such as structural modeling, load combinations, analysis techniques, and detailing practices. Additional training in the integration of ETABS with other packages like AutoCAD and Revit is also offered in some courses, which could be beneficial for practitioners in the construction industry. The instructor’s background needs to be examined. Field-experienced instructors can provide more insight and give real-life examples. They can simplify complex content through their delivery style. Verifying the background of an instructor, reading feedback from previous students, and watching demo lectures if available are recommended. A good instructor not only trains in the software but also explains how it is applied in real projects.
